Autonomous Agent Engineer

NVIDIA AI, Santa Clara, CA, United States


About the Role
We’re building the infrastructure that lets AI agents operate autonomously and securely at NVIDIA. This role owns the execution environments, state management systems, and security boundaries that make autonomous agents safe and reliable. The team designs and ships SDKs, CLIs, and developer tooling that turn complex sandboxing into a straightforward experience for agent builders and users across the company.

What You’ll Be Doing
The day-to-day is designing and building infrastructure that other engineers depend on:

Architect sandboxed compute environments where agents securely execute code, access tools, and interact with external services

Design and ship SDKs (Python, Go) and CLI tooling for provisioning and managing agent workloads in isolated environments

Create onboarding templates, reference implementations, and CLI workflows that make secure execution the default

Build state management for long-running agent operations, including checkpoint and recovery

Embed security into SDK primitives like isolation policies, secrets injection, network policies, capability declarations, and kill switches

Engineer auth integrations for workload identity, delegated tool access, and scope attenuation without static secrets

Build observability and audit infrastructure: structured logs, decision traces, security telemetry, and audit trails wired into enterprise monitoring
